#1345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1345ab is composed of 7.5% red, 27.1%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 220.3 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 37.3%. #1345ab color hex could be obtained by blending #268aff with #000057.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#1345ab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1345ab has RGB values of R:19, G:69, B:171 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1263019.

Hex triplet 1345ab #1345ab
RGB Decimal 19, 69, 171 rgb(19,69,171)
RGB Percent 7.5, 27.1, 67.1 rgb(7.5%,27.1%,67.1%)
CMYK 89, 60, 0, 33
HSL 220.3°, 80, 37.3 hsl(220.3,80%,37.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 220.3°, 88.9, 67.1
Web Safe 003399 #003399
CIE-LAB 32.556, 24.733, -58.836
XYZ 9.746, 7.334, 39.428
xyY 0.172, 0.13, 7.334
CIE-LCH 32.556, 63.824, 292.8
CIE-LUV 32.556, -14.421, -80.854
Hunter-Lab 27.082, 16.843, -67.362
Binary 00010011, 01000101, 10101011

Shades and Tints of #1345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050c is the darkest color, while #f9f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1345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e62 is the less saturated color, while #0440ba is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1345ab is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#424242 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#394357 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0053a2 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#00578e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#005e63 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#064ea5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#065198 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#06557d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
